Financial Services Overview
 

The Financial Services division assists companies that are limited in their ability to hire and maintain quality financial management. Our team of financial professionals offers knowledge and expertise on a part-time basis, providing management typically performed by a full-time Chief Financial Officer, Treasurer, or Controller.

Financial Function

Chief Financial Officer:

  • Accounting Firm (Auditor) Selection
  • Asset Planning and Preservation
    • Maximize return on assets
    • Optimize cost of capital
    • Strategic financial planning
  • Bank Relations
    • Negotiate lines of credit
    • Debt restructuring
  • CFO Sounding Board
  • Investor Relations
  • Manage Legal and Tax Activities
  • MIS Management
  • Venture Capital Funding
    • Determine needs
    • Negotiate term

Controller:

  • Accounting Systems
    • Automated or manual
    • Inventory control (MRP/JIT)
    • Payroll
    • Accounts receivable/billing
    • General ledger
  • Budgeting, Planning, and Forecasting
  • Monthly Financial Statements
    • Interpreting, analyzing, and communicating financial results
    • Performance analysis
  • SEC Reporting
  • Tax Planning and Administration
    • Calculate and supervise payment of Federal, State, Franchise, and Payroll taxes

Treasurer:

  • Cash Management
    • Establish monitoring systems
    • Credit management
    • Accounts payable management
  • Benefit Administration
    • Stock option plans
    • Health insurance
    • Pension and 401K plans
  • Insurance and Risk Management
    • Evaluate insurance needs
    • Foreign exchange risk
  • Stock Plan Administration
